All-New Citroen C3 Now On-Sale

by under News on 17 Nov 2010 01:47:54 PM17 Nov 2010

Exuding typical French charisma and handily priced from $19,990, Citroen’s all-new C3 small car is targeted to bring younger buyers to the brand.

Now on sale, the all-new Citroen C3 is comprehensively equipped and available in the model grades – VT, VTR+ and Exclusive. The entry-level VT model is powered by a 54kW/118Nm, 1.4-litre petrol engine while the two other grades offer a choice of 88kW/160Nm, 1.6-litre petrol or 66kW/215Nm turbo-diesel powerplants.

Drive is to the front wheels via a five speed manual transmission in the VT model. VTR+ and Exclusive models with the petrol engine drive through a four-speed automatic, while the diesel-powered versions are only available with a five-speed manual.

A key styling feature of the new Citroen C3 is its massive ‘Zenith’ windscreen. Measuring 1.35-metres from the bonnet to the roof, Citroen says the C3’s windscreen is 36 per cent larger than an average five-door hatchback.

It’s not just about good looks though – despite the compact dimensions (nine centimeters shorter than a Peugeot 207), the Citroen C3 delivers up to 300-litres of luggage space.

Inside is a nice combination of quality materials and chrome trim plus a scented air freshener in the air-conditioning system.

Safety is impressive with VTR+ and Exclusive models fitted with six airbags (the entry-level VT has four airbags, missing-out on the full-length curtain airbags) plus standard Electronic Stability Program (ESP).

The full Citroen C3 range is:

VT (petrol manual only) $19,990
VTR+ (petrol automatic) $23,490
VTR+ (diesel manual) $23,990
Exclusive (petrol automatic) $25,990
Exclusive (diesel manual) $26,490
